Take Care of the Roof and Gutters

The roof and gutters work together to protect your home from water damage. Check the roof for missing shingles or damaged areas after storms. Clean gutters regularly to remove leaves and debris that can block water flow. Overflowing gutters may lead to foundation problems, roof leaks, and damage to exterior walls. Keeping these areas in good condition helps prevent expensive repairs.

Refresh Paint and Decorative Features

Paint protects exterior surfaces while giving your home a clean and modern look. If paint begins to peel, crack, or fade, consider repainting the affected areas. Also inspect doors, shutters, fences, and railings for signs of wear. A fresh coat of paint on these features can greatly improve the overall appearance of the property without requiring major renovations.

Check Outdoor Lighting

Outdoor lighting improves both safety and appearance. Replace burned-out bulbs and clean light fixtures regularly so they provide bright illumination. Well-placed lighting highlights your home’s best features and makes walkways safer for family members and visitors during the evening.
